Ok apparently my computer and cell phone both hate me because I can't log into my account on my own game. Upon using the CAPTCHA it gives me a constant wrong code issue.

I went into the error log and here is the error...

[01-Dec-2012 00:21:02] PHP Warning: session_start() [<a href='function.session-start'>function.session-start</a>]: Cannot send session cookie - headers already sent in /****/****/****/willoftheninja.net/config.php on line 4

[01-Dec-2012 00:21:02] PHP Warning: session_start() [<a href='function.session-start'>function.session-start</a>]: Cannot send session cache limiter - headers already sent in /***/****/***/willoftheninja.net/config.php on line 4

I went into config.php and there isn't an issue there, I googled the problem and nothing seemed helpful even taking out the white space like recommended.

I went into a friends room and used his computer and logged on fine no issues.

So this seems to be centered around my computers cookies right?

So I cleared out all my cookies and hell even my browsing data(have to clear out the porn sooner or later) and temporary files.

Closed my browser tried logging in, gave me the same error.

Switched between IE and Firefox, same error.
